»OS Deployer »Free Windows Tools Awards Description Desktop Central supports two modes of viewing the remote computers, viz. ActiveX Viewer and HTML5 Viewer. The ActiveX viewer uses the browsers ActiveX components. The browser from where the connection is established will therefore have the ActiveX controls enabled. Here are the steps to enable ActiveX controls in Internet Explorer. how to enable activex in ie Steps to enable ActiveX controls in Internet Explorer Select Tools --> Internet Options menu from the Internet Explorer. Select the Security tab from the Internet Options dialog. Select the appropriate Web content zone and click Custom Level. Make the following options available under ActiveX controls and plug-ins to either enableor Prompt: Download signed ActiveX controls Run ActiveX controls and plug-ins Script ActiveX controls marked safe for scripting Click Ok to save the security settings. Click OK to save and close the Internet Options dialog. Note: It is recommended to add the Desktop Central server URL under trusted site zone of Interent explorer. this Article Home » Categories » Computers and Electronics » Internet » Internet Browsers » Internet Explorer ArticleEditDiscuss Edit ArticleHow to Activate Active X Community Q&A If you are using an older version of Internet Explorer, browsing modern websites can be really difficult. Every time you encounter a website that uses Adobe Flash or some other type of Internet application, you have to manually activate Active X (something that controls Internet applications on Internet Explorer), otherwise you won't be able to really use the website at all. Fortunately, learning how to activate Active X is an easy process that shouldn't take more than several minutes. Steps 1 Click on "Tools" in the Internet Explorer toolbar. Go down to "Options." 2 Click on "Security" and then set a "Custom Level." 3 Select "ActiveX Controls and Plug-ins." 4 Make sure that "Enable" is checked next to "ActiveX Controls and Plug-ins." Enable "Script ActiveX Controls Marked Safe for Scripting" as well. 5 Confirm the changes and hit "Apply" to ensure that they take effect. Tips Active X is primarily an issue in Internet Explorer 6 and 7. If you are running Windows XP or Windows Vista, you may be running one of these outdated versions of Internet Explorer. If you don't want to deal with Active X at all, switch to a different browser or update your version of Internet Explorer to the latest one. Microsoft has made many improvements to how Internet Explorer loads Internet-based applications, and the Active X control has been essentially eliminated from the latest versions.
